Seniors Will You Sell Your Vote for $200?

Despite his bluster, Trump realizes that his campaign is in deep trouble, and he will do anything to right the boat, including using your taxpayer dollars to buy votes.  We have already seen evidence of that when he announced that his administration would spend billions of dollars to rebuild the infrastructure of hurricane and earthquake ravaged Puerto Rico.  The people he is trying to bribe are not the residents of the island territory itself (they can’t vote in presidential elections), but the thousands of former Puerto Rican residents who have moved to Florida, a key battleground state. 

Now Trump is using your money to try to buy the votes of senior citizens who are Medicare and Medicaid subscribers. He has long bragged that he has brought down the cost of prescription drugs with absolutely no evidence to back up that claim.  Also a problem is that unlike in 2016, older voters are starting to shy away from Trump.

According to AARP, in the last presidential election, those 65 and older made up 15% of the voters. In that election, Trump won 53% of the 65 and older voters while Clinton won only 44%.  This demographic victory, especially in battleground states, played a large part in putting Trump in the White House.  However, older Americans have been disproportionately affected by the COVID-19 pandemic and many hold Trump’s cavalier handling of the pandemic responsible for the deaths of friends and loved ones.  A recent Quinnipiac University shows Biden leading Trump by 10 points among voters 65 and older.

Trump’s solution? He will now try to buy the votes of older Americans with money taken from the already underfunded Social Security fund.  Trump has ordered that each of the 33 million Americans enrolled in Medicare and Medicaid will receive a $200 gift card from the federal government which can be used to pay for prescription drug co-pays.  Originally Trump was negotiating with the big pharmaceutical companies to have them fund the card.  However, that deal fell apart because the drug companies did not want to be seen as taking sides by funding what was clearly a political stunt immediately before the election.

Casting about in trying to find a way to fund the program, Trump’s minions decided to use an obscure feature of the Medicare law which allows the government to fund pilot programs that are designed to save money.  Of course, since this is obviously a cash give away it won’t save any money, so it is yet another example of Trump abusing his powers until and unless someone or something stops him.

Of course, Trump wants the cards issued before the election. However, his administration is in a tizzy just trying to get letters out to the recipients over the next few weeks telling them they will receive the cards because it is almost impossible to get the cards themselves out before the election.  Trump has ordered that the letters give him full credit for the handout.  Just sending out those letters will cost the government $19 million.
